Trust and betrayal, coercion and compliance, cruel truth and 'friendly deceit'--these are among the themes in this latest collection of stories by prizewinning author Greg Johnson. A young man knows his father really didn't die in Vietnam but isn't sure he's ready for his mother to tell him the truth. An emotionally distraught wife copes with her husband's infidelity. Watching a disturbing Gene Tierney film on the 'Million Dollar Movie, ' a ten-year-old boy learns that there are more dangerous fevers than the one keeping him home from school. And as her boyfriend loads the stolen silver on his pickup truck, a female con artist teaches a childless woman a bitter lesson about motherhood.Johnson, Greg is the author of 'A Friendly Deceit (Johns Hopkins: Poetry and Fiction)', published 1992 under ISBN 9780801844065 and ISBN 0801844061.
